Ask any IT administrator whose office suffered a complete network crash what caused the outage. In almost every case, the culprit was an unmanaged desktop switch that developed a loop or a damaged patch cable that flooded the network with broadcast packets. The CiscoEnterprise Managed Network Switches is built with enterprise switching silicon, hardware loop protection, and automated storm control that isolates faults to a single port without affecting the rest of the building. A 60-user corporate consulting firm near Anandnagar suffered daily network freezes because staff computers, a guest Wi-Fi router, and twelve IP security cameras were sharing an unmanaged 24-port hub. We deployed a 48-port CiscoEnterprise Managed Network Switches Layer-2 managed switch, configured isolated VLANs for Management, Accounts, Cameras, and Guests, and enabled RSTP loop protection. Network broadcast storms ceased immediately, internet speeds remained steady across all desks, and the accounting department operates on an isolated, secure network segment.

Q. What is hardware stacking and how does it differ from daisy-chaining?
Daisy-chaining connects switches using standard patch cables, creating a narrow 1Gbps bottleneck between units and requiring separate management for each switch. Hardware stacking uses dedicated high-speed cables (up to 160Gbps) to combine up to eight switches into a single virtual switch with a single management IP address and unified configuration.
Q. Why is connecting the switch to an online double-conversion UPS so critical?
Commercial building power in India experiences frequent voltage sags and generator changeovers. When voltage drops, switch power supplies can reset, knocking all connected computers, phones, and PoE cameras offline. An online double-conversion UPS supplies clean, continuous AC power without transfer pauses, preventing port restarts.

Q. What is the difference between multi-mode and single-mode optical fiber?
Multi-mode optical fiber (OM3/OM4 with orange or aqua jackets) uses 850nm SFP+ transceivers for high-speed connections inside the same building up to 300 meters. Single-mode optical fiber (OS2 with yellow jackets) uses 1310nm SFP+ transceivers for long-distance campus and inter-building runs up to 10 kilometers or more.
